When NAFTA first kicked in, the economic landscape of North America started to shift, guys. The initial years saw a significant increase in trade between the three countries. Businesses began to restructure their supply chains, taking advantage of the comparative advantages each nation offered. For instance, assembly plants in Mexico started utilizing more components sourced from the US and Canada, while Canadian companies found new markets for their goods south of the border. This **interconnectedness** was a hallmark of the NAFTA era. However, it wasn't all smooth sailing. While trade volumes soared, the impact on jobs and wages was a complex story. In some sectors, particularly in the US, certain manufacturing jobs were indeed displaced as companies moved production to Mexico to take advantage of lower labor costs. This led to significant disruption for workers in those industries and fueled much of the criticism leveled against NAFTA. On the other hand, other sectors experienced job growth, driven by increased exports and new opportunities in areas like logistics, services, and high-tech manufacturing. Canada also saw shifts, with some industries benefiting greatly from access to the US market, while others faced increased competition. Mexico experienced a boom in its manufacturing sector, particularly in areas like automotive and electronics, leading to significant job creation, though questions remained about the quality of those jobs and their impact on local communities. The agreement also had to navigate evolving global economic trends. As the digital age dawned and globalization accelerated, the dynamics of trade and investment continued to change. NAFTA, while groundbreaking, was a product of its time, and its framework had to adapt, or be seen as needing to adapt, to these new realities. The initial promise of broad prosperity was being tested by the realities of global competition, technological change, and the uneven distribution of benefits across different sectors and populations within each country. This early impact set the stage for ongoing debates about NAFTA's true success and its legacy.
